WebSpectrum Internet Assist program only costs about $14.99/month. This cost is fixed, and it doesn’t change at all during your subscription period. It means no price hike, and you even get a free Spectrum self-installation kit. You can also get a Spectrum WiFi connection for $5/month with a free wireless router and no activation charges. Web25 feb. 2024 · EBB Program Overview. In the Consolidated Appropriations Act of 2024, Congress appropriated $3.2 billion to the FCC to help low-income households pay for broadband service and connected internet devices. WebA $30 per month benefit to help households afford access to Spectrum high-speed internet service. Up to a $75 per month discount if the household is on qualifying tribal lands. A … WebYou are eligible for the ACP if your income is 200% or less than the Federal Poverty Guidelines (see the table below). The guideline is based on your household size and state. The table below reflects the income limit by household size, which is 200% of the 2024 Federal Poverty Guidelines.
